Moments after President Uhuru Kenyatta named part of his new cabinet, Kenyans have come out questioning about a name that was conspicuously absent - Ababu Namwamba.

Many had expected that the former Budalangi MP would be among President Uhuru Kenyatta's favourite candidates for a cabinet slot after ditching ODM to join Jubilee under his Labour Party.
